﻿html, body, div, span, applet, object,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p, small, str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{
	margin: 0;
	padding: 0;
	outline: 0;
	font-weight: inherit;
	font-style: inherit;
	font-size: 100%;
	text-decoration:none;
	text-indent:inherit;
}


@charset "utf-8";
/* CSS Reset */
body,table,th,td,div,ul,li,dl,dt,dd,p,h1,h2,h3,h4,form,input,button{margin:0;padding:0}
body{
	font:14px/24px "微软雅黑";
	color:#0d203d;
}
img{border:0}
a{text-decoration:none;color:#0d203d; cursor:pointer}
#gg0
{
	cursor:pointer;z-index:10000;
}
#gg1
{
	cursor:pointer;
}
#gg2
{
	cursor:pointer;
}
#Layer000
{
	cursor:pointer;
}
.webfont2
{
	cursor:pointer;
}
ul,li{list-style:none}
.clearFix:after{
	clear:both;
	display:block;
	visibility:hidden;
	height:0;
	line-height:0;
	content:"";
}
.clearFix{zoom:1;}


/*header*/
.top {
	height:42px;
	background:url(../images/top-bg.jpg) repeat-x;
}
.top .top-inner {
	width:1208px;
	margin:0 auto;
	height:42px;
	overflow:hidden;
}
.top .time {
	float:left;
	height:42px;
	width:160px;
	line-height:42px;
}
.top .weather {
	float:left;
	width:200px;
	height:42px;
	line-height:42px;
}

.top .weather22 {
	float:left;
	width:142px;
	height:42px;
	line-height:42px;
}

.top .weather2 {
	float:left;
	width:76px;
	height:42px;
	line-height:42px;
}
.search {
	float:left;
	height:28px;
	margin-top:5px;
	border:1px solid #c7c7c7;
	background-color:#ffffff;
}
.s-option {
	float:left;
	width:74px;
	height:28px;
	background:url(../images/input-split.jpg) 100% 0 no-repeat;
}
.s-option span {
	display:block;
	width:70px;
	height:28px;
	line-height:28px;
	text-align:center;
	color:#666666;
	cursor:pointer;
}
.s-input {
	float:left;
	width:145px;
	height:28px;
	overflow:hidden;
}
.s-input input {
	width:135px;
	height:28px;
	border:0;
	font-family:"微软雅黑";
	font-size:14px;
	padding-left:10px;
	line-height:24px;
}
.s-button {
	float:left;
	width:57px;
	height:28px;
}
.s-button input {
	width:57px;
	height:28px;
	background:url(../images/search-btn.jpg) no-repeat;
	cursor:pointer;
	border:0;
}
.login {
	float:right;
	width: 70px;
	height:30px;
	margin-top:5px;
}
.login2 {
	float:right;
	width: 68px;
	height:30px;
	margin-top:5px;
}
.login3 {
	float:right;
	width:76px;
	height:30px;
	margin-top:5px;
}
.login4 {
	float:right;
	width:77px;
	height:30px;
	margin-top:5px;
}
.login5 {
	float:right;
	width:69px;
	height:30px;
	margin-top:5px;
}
.l-option {
	float:left;
	width:100px;
	height:28px;
	padding-left:10px;
	line-height:26px;
	color:#666666;
	cursor:pointer;
	background:url(../images/down-icon.jpg) 80% 50% no-repeat;
}
.l-button {
	float:left;
	width: 62px;
	height:30px;
	background: url(../images/nbdl_05.png) right center no-repeat;
}
.l-button2 {
	float:left;
	width: 60px;
	height:30px;
	background: url(../images/ztdl_05.png) right center no-repeat;
}
.l-button3 {
	float:left;
	width:69px;
	height:30px;
	background:url(../images/nbdl_05_1.jpg) no-repeat;
}
.l-button4 {
	float:left;
	width:69px;
	height:30px;
	background:url(../images/nbdl_05_2.jpg) no-repeat;
}
.l-button5 {
	float:left;
	width:69px;
	height:30px;
	background:url(../images/cazx.jpg) no-repeat;
}
.l-button6 {
	float:left;
	width:69px;
	height:30px;
	background:url(../images/spdr.jpg) no-repeat;
}
.logo {
	height:168px;
	width:1208px;
	margin:0 auto;
}
.mt10 {margin-top:10px;}
.ml10 {margin-left:10px;}
.ml5 {margin-left:5px;}
.ml13 {margin-left:13px;}
.ml14 {margin-left:14px;}
.mt1 {margin-top:1px;}
.span8 {
    float: left;
    width: 326px;
}
.span12 {
    float: left;
    width: 489px;
}

.span5 {
    float: left;
    width: 200px;
}

.span6 {
    float: left;
    width: 242px;
}
.span3 {
    float: left;
    width: 121px;
}
.span51 {
    float: left;
    width: 285px;
}
.span52 {
    float: left;
    width: 115px;
}
.span53 {
    float: left;
    width: 180px;
}
.span54 {
    float: left;
    width: 110px;
}
.span55 {
    float: left;
    width: 145px;
}
/*footer*/
.footer {
	width:1208px;
	margin:0 auto;
	height:64px;
	position:relative;
}
.footlogo{
	position:absolute;
	left:330px;
	top:20;
	width:80px;
	height:80px;
	}

.footerp
{
	position:absolute;
	left:420px;
	top:0;
	color:#ffffff;
	font-size:12px;
	line-height:22px;
	text-align:center;
	height:80px;
	padding-top:20px;
}
.footerwx
{
	position:absolute;
	left:930px;
	top:0;
	color:#ffffff;
	font-size:12px;
	line-height:22px;
	text-align:center;
	height:80px;
	padding-top:8px;
}
.footerfg
{
	position:absolute;
	left:1000px;
	top:0;
	color:#ffffff;
	font-size:12px;
	line-height:22px;
	text-align:center;
	height:80px;
	padding-top:13px;
}
.footerwb
{
	position:absolute;
	left:1110px;
	top:0;
	color:#ffffff;
	font-size:12px;
	line-height:22px;
	text-align:center;
	height:80px;
	padding-top:8px;
}
.footerzc
{
	position:absolute;
	left:230px;
	padding-top:13px;
}


/*二级页面LeftMenu*/
.LeftMenu{
	display:block;
	height:40px;
	background:url(../images/037.jpg) no-repeat;
	line-height:40px;
	font-family:SimSun-ExtB;
	color:#ffffff;
	font-size:15px;
	text-align:left;
	text-indent:15px;
	cursor:pointer;
}
.LeftMenuOut
{
	display:block;
	height:40px;
	background:url(../images/027.jpg) no-repeat;
	line-height:40px;
	font-family:SimSun-ExtB;
	color:#ffffff;
	font-size:15px;
	text-align:left;
	text-indent:15px;
	cursor:pointer;
}
.LeftMenu:hover,.LeftMenuOut:hover{
	font-weight:bold;
	color:#8d0800;
	background:url(../images/027.jpg) no-repeat;
	text-decoration:underline;
}

.LeftMenuSub:hover{
	font-weight:bold;
	color:#8d0800;
}
.LeftMenuSub{
	display:block;
	height:40px;	
	line-height:40px;
	font-family:SimSun-ExtB;
	color:#8d0800;
	font-size:12px;
	text-align:center;
}

.LeftMenuSub1 a:hover{
	font-weight:bold;
	color:#8d0800;
}
.LeftMenuSub1 a{
	display:block;
	height:40px;	
	line-height:40px;
	font-family:SimSun-ExtB;
	color:#8d0800;
	font-size:12px;padding-left:90px;
	text-align:left;
}

.LeftMenuSub a:hover{
	font-weight:bold;
	color:#8d0800;
}
.LeftMenuSub a{
	display:block;
	height:40px;	
	line-height:40px;
	font-family:SimSun-ExtB;
	color:#8d0800;
	font-size:12px;padding-left:90px;
	text-align:left;
}

.MoreinfoColor {
	padding-top:10px;
	color:#F93;
}

/*moreinfosub样式*/
.more06
{
	background:url(../../../WebImages/sub_01_04.gif) no-repeat;
	width:17px;
	height:42px;
}
.more07
{
	background:url(../../../WebImages/sub_01_01.gif) no-repeat;
	height:42px;
	width:16px;
}
.more08
{
	background:url(../../../WebImages/sub_01_02.gif) no-repeat;
	height:42px;
}


.more09
{
	background:url(../../../WebImages/sub_01_bg1.gif) repeat-x;
	width:250px;
	height:42px;
}

.more10
{
	background:url(../../../WebImages/sub_03_01.gif) no-repeat;
	height:18px;
}
.more11
{
	background:url(../../../WebImages/sub_03_bg.gif) repeat-x;
	height:18px;
}
.more12
{
	background:url(../../../WebImages/sub_03_02.gif) no-repeat;
	height:18px;
}
.date { float:right;}


.infodetailattachfile
{
	border-right: 0px solid #6AAAA3;
	border-top: 0px solid #6AAAA3;
	border-left: 0px solid #6AAAA3;
	border-bottom: 0px solid #6AAAA3;
	background-image: url(../images/dots/dottzcy.gif);
	background-repeat: no-repeat;
	background-position: left center;
	padding-left: 15px;
	width: 120px;
	height: 22px;
	color: #F00;
	cursor: hand;
	background-color: Transparent;
}
.polltitle{ text-align:center; font-family:"微软雅黑"; font-size:16px; color:#333;}
.showpollselect{ font-family:"微软雅黑"; font-size:16px; color:#333;}
.songti{width:30px}

a:visited, span.MsoHyperlinkFollowed
{
	text-decoration:none;
}
.webfont{cursor:pointer;}


.ncbg-top{ border-top: 1px solid #d8cece;}
.widthleft{
	float: left;
	width: 662px;
}
.clearfix {
    *zoom: 1;
}

.clearfix:before,
.clearfix:after {
    display: table;
    line-height: 0;
    content: "";
}

.clearfix:after {
    clear: both;
}
